Best Christmas Light Displays in the Triangle

Our team has pulled together some of the best Christmas light displays in the Triangle for 2020.

Lights on the Neuse Old-fashion Christmas Hayride

Lights on the Neuse Clayton

The Lights on the Neuse is a traditional Christmas Hayride through the Boyette Farm here in Clayton. Located at the corner of Covered Bridge Road and Loop Road, you are cordially invited to bring your friends and family and celebrate the magic of the Christmas season at Lights on the Neuse.

Hours of operation: Weather permitting (check their Facebook page for the schedule)
Cost: Age 3 and up -10.00 (Hayride and a physically distanced Santa Photo) Age 2 and under – Free

The Christmas Village at the Tobacco Life Farm Museum in Kenly

Christmas Village at Tobacco Life Museum Kenly

The Tobacco Life Museum Christmas Village is a drive-thru Christmas light show on the property and it’s offered on the first two Fridays and Saturdays of December. This a 20-minute drive-thru experience that also offers hotdogs, and concessions for purchase. It’s a safe experience for one and all.

Hours of operation: Dec. 11th & 12th from 5 pm to 8 pm.
Cost: $10/car. Only cash is accepted for tickets purchased at the gate. Advance ticket can be purchased here!

Planter’s Walk Neighborhood Greenway Christmas Light Tour

Planter’s Walk Greenway Christmas Lights Knightdale

Neighbors who backup to the Planter’s Walk Greenway in Knightdale decorate for the Christmas season each year with festive lights and snowmaking machines. It is recommended you park in the community pool parking lot to access the greenway. Be careful walking across Lynwood Road as it can be very busy.

Hours of operation: Dark until?
Cost: Free

Christmas Lights on the Farm Middlesex

For a downhome on the farm Christmas, it’s hard to beat the Christmas Lights on the Farm hosted in Middlesex. Experience hayrides through a field of lights, a bonfire, pictures with Santa, a visit to Santa’s workshop and Big Daddy’s General Store where you’ll feast on old fashioned candy, s’mores, and plenty of hot chocolate and hot apple cider (purchased at the concession stand).

There will be special nights for carollers along with Santa and Bucky the Reindeer!

Hours of operation: Open 6:00 pm – 8:00 pm. Be sure to check this web page for open dates.
Cost: 3 and under free, 4 and up: $8. You can purchase tickets online here.

Night of Lights at Dix Park Raleigh

Nights of Lights Dix Park Raleigh

Located in the Dix Park at 75 Hunt Drive, Raleigh, this drive-through Christmas light display is 1.3 miles of illuminated trees, light displays and also incorporates local art.

Hours of operation: Select nights from December 16th through December 31st, 2020 from 5:30 p.m to 10 p.m. or 11 p.m.
Cost: $15/car. $30/vehicle that holds 9 or more. Discounts will be offered on Dec 28th & 29th. Purchase tickets in advance here.

Lights on the Meadow Christmas Light Display

Lights on the Meadow Raleigh

Located at 9301 Hay Meadow Court in Raleigh, the Lights on the Meadow display is a drive-by experience. You are asked to tune to 88.3 FM to enjoy the lights synced to music. It is important to note that the light show is located in a residential community. Drivers are encouraged to remain in your vehicle and proceed to the end of the cul-de-sac where you can turn around to exit.

Hours of Operation: Light shows are scheduled for December 5th – 31st 2020. Mon – Thurs 6:00 pm – 9:00 pm, Fri – Sat 6:00 pm – 10:00 pm, Sun 6:00 pm – 9:00 pm
Cost: Free

Piper Lights in Wake Forest

Piper Lights Wake Forest

What started with a tiny manger scene 30 years ago has evolved into 7 acres of pure Christmas lighted joy! Piper Lights is a local, family-run Christmas light drive-thru display that is located off at 5725 Fixit Shop Road in Wake Forest.

Due to the pandemic, the family will not operate the candy store nor the train this year.

Hours of operation: please visit the Piper Lights Facebook page.
Cost: Free (donations accepted)

Lake Myra Christmas Light Display in Downtown Wendell

Lake Myra Lights Wendell

The Lake Myra Christmas Lights is one of the biggest and most popular light shows in the Triangle. The light display is located in the Wendell town park and operates through December 31st, 2020.

Hours of operation: Sunday to Thursday from 5:30 p.m. to 10 p.m and Friday and Saturday from 5:30 p.m. to 11 p.m. Each show is 25 minutes in length with a 5-minute intermission between each show.
Cost: Free (donations are accepted.)
